Hailed as one of the best sectorial networking events of the year, the CILT’s NW Region Awards for Education & Excellence promote and showcase individual and corporate best practice within the freight and passenger transport industry and are supported by organisations and individuals from throughout the North West.

Hosted by the BBC's Dave Guest the awards evening guarantees to challenge and inform with maximum enjoyment and entertainment.  12 Awards will be presented in the following individual and corporate categories.

•     Student of the Year
•     Young Freight Logistics Manager of the Year
•     Young Passenger Transport Manager of the Year
•     Service to the Industry in Freight Logistics
•     Service to the Industry in Passenger Transport
•     Lifetime Achievement Award
•     Best Practice Award
•     Development of People Award
•     Environmental Improvement Award
•     Information Management Award
•     Safety Award
•     Transport Policy, Planning & Implementation Award
•     Warehouse Operations Award

How to Enter?
To enter, nominators should supply one entry form per submission as an electronic copy with a maximum of 2,500 words per entry to be submitted via email to simon.reynish@btinternet.com who will confirm receipt electronically within 24 hours, if not call him on 07725 070184. Supporting material is allowed to give an illustration of the project or projects in which the nominee has been involved.  For the corporate awards, supporting material is permissible, but only to explain the entry and provide amplification of the project goals and therefore must be totally relevant to the project and entrants may be contacted for further information by the judging panel.  The deadline for entries will be 1700 hrs, Friday 31st March 2017, with the outcome of entries to be confirmed, by email, before end of play on Monday 1st May 2017.

For the individual categories the judges will be looking for:
•     Evidence of personal impact on task/s described
•     Significant influence over business operations
•     Demonstration of desire to drive their own career
•     Level of innovation/desire to challenge the status quo
•     Evidence of sustained success in previous roles

Whilst for the corporate awards they will look for:
•     Effectiveness and impact of output in the situation described
•     Use of innovative ideas or the extension of good practice into new areas
•     Success in overcoming technical challenges and other difficulties
•     Its wider significance and applicability in other organisations
•     Quantification of the scale/size/benefits

NB: Judges will make their decision based on the project and its benefits to your organisation.
